RF NV Manager 1434 is a component of the QPST (Qualcomm Product Support Tool) suite . Its primary function is to provide a dedicated interface for reading and writing RF-specific NV items stored in a device's modem. rf nv manager 1434 best

The modern smartphone ecosystem is defined by the convergence of multiple wireless standards—GSM, CDMA, WCDMA, LTE, and 5G NR—within a single device. Each standard requires specific calibration parameters, often stored in Non-Volatile (NV) memory. As devices transition to support massive MIMO and mmWave frequencies, the volume and complexity of this RF data have grown exponentially.

In Qualcomm's RF architecture, items in the 1400-range, such as 1434, dictate RF Calibration Values —specifically managing Low Noise Amplifier (LNA) behavior and cellular frequency bands (like CDMA, LTE, or GSM) to ensure optimal signal gain and device connectivity.
